The post holder will be required to provide Podiatric care in patients' homes, community clinics and nursing homes. This is a permanent full time post (37.5 hours) working across Monday to Friday with some evenings. Podiatry bases are at Boston House and Leigh Health Centre.


You will be encouraged to attend training relevant to your role .


An Enhanced DBS with Adults' Barred list check will be obtained during pre-employment checks.


The postholder must be able to travel across Trust independently. NHS/UK healthcare experience is essential (voluntary/employment/placement).


We will accept student applications - appointment to the post would be subject to the successful completion of a degree or higher degree in Podiatry during 2024.


Our podiatry caseload focuses on those who are medically at risk so consequently our patients tend to be complex with a variety of needs.


Based in the Community division but you will need to be able to travel across Ashton, Wigan and Leigh.

To be responsible for the assessment, diagnosis, planning, implementation and evaluation of podiatric care to patients with a variety of medical and podiatric problems.
To carry out nail surgery procedures.
Planning and Organisational Duties


To carry out annual Diabetes assessments in all clinics. Identification of risk factors, categorising patients into specific risk bands following assessment findings.
Referral to other services if required e.g. further vascular assessment, District Nursing, GP.
Provision of specific foot care advice in order to prevent deterioration / maintain / improve foot health.

To refer on to other health care professionals when appropriate through agreed pathways, e.g. referrals to podiatry assistant, biomechanics service.
To follow departmental and Trust policies. To assist in the development and implementation of procedures and guidelines. To carry out clerical duties when necessary.
